NAIA to MOA: SHOPPING JUST GOT A HUGE UPGRADE!

Imagine stepping off a long flight, the exhaustion settling in, and instead of navigating the usual post-arrival chaos, a comfortable ride awaits. Duty Free Philippines is now offering complimentary shuttle service to arriving passengers at Ninoy Aquino International Airport, whisking them away to a world of shopping possibilities.

This isn’t just about convenience; it’s about reimagining the travel experience. In collaboration with the Department of Tourism and the “Love PH” campaign, a hop-on, hop-off shuttle will extend duty-free access far beyond the airport terminals themselves, opening up a new realm of possibilities for travelers.

The destination? The expansive Luxe Duty Free store in the SM Mall of Asia Complex. This isn’t a quick stop, but an invitation to explore a curated selection of goods, offering a seamless transition from international travel to local leisure.

But the changes don’t stop with transportation. Duty Free Philippines is actively expanding its retail footprint within key airports, envisioning larger, more modern spaces designed to elevate the shopping experience.

This modernization isn’t merely cosmetic. It’s a commitment to providing Filipino travelers with exceptional value and service, a promise held firm for nearly four decades. The goal is to create a retail network that anticipates and exceeds expectations.

To celebrate its 39th anniversary, Duty Free Philippines is unveiling a series of enticing discounts. From May 1st to 3rd, shoppers at the Luxe Duty Free store can enjoy savings of up to 30% on select items.

The anniversary celebrations won’t be confined to a single location. From May 22nd to 31st, these promotional offers will extend to Duty Free stores across the nation’s airports, ensuring more travelers can partake in the festivities.

At its core, Duty Free Philippines operates as an agency closely aligned with the Department of Tourism, working to enhance the overall travel experience for Filipinos and visitors alike. This latest initiative underscores that dedication.
